Output ec538dc54bdfc42f8e03291899564c2d91dcf4ecea6ce3dff462eec62414f9ac:0

value
58387
script pubkey
OP_0 OP_PUSHBYTES_20 93655789d0b184672d39a5a362e3a9867da5ff98
address
bc1qjdj40zwskxzxwtfe5k3k9cafse76tluc2qw6um
transaction
ec538dc54bdfc42f8e03291899564c2d91dcf4ecea6ce3dff462eec62414f9ac
spent
true